- [ ] Step 7: Archive cold storage buckets (Glacierline tier). Confirm both ceremony witnesses are present, verify bucket manifests match the Oxbow ledger, then seal the archive key shares. Plugin authors may observe but not handle shares. Once sealed, the archive index itself is encrypted and can only be reopened with the passphrase below.

vault phrase of badup-hahig = tamael-aldael-kelmir-istael-fenok-istwyn-tamius-jorath-oliion

## Runbook: Gaugepile Sidecar — Release Checklist

Heads up: the sidecar ships with every app pod, so a bad config fans out fast. Before cutting a release, confirm the flush interval hasn't drifted from what the Tallyhouse aggregator expects, or you'll see sawtooth gaps in dashboards. Rollbacks are cheap — just repin the image tag. Canary one node pool first, watch for ten minutes, then proceed. The values to verify against are these.

config for bagep-yafof:
quenath:
  pin: 8584
  metrics_host: metrics.quenath.tolvaqsys.internal
  tenant: pelath
  seal: seal_ed102645

## Releases

Hey support folks — quick notes on ProfileMesh shard releases. Each release re-balances user-profile shards gradually, so don't panic if a lookup lands on a stale shard for a few minutes post-deploy; it self-heals. Release bundles are published twice a month and are always signed. If a customer asks you to verify a bundle they downloaded, walk them through the checksum step using the public signing key below.

deploy key for kawif-bageg: bky19_YQNdHDgpaLxUNwPoHm9

**GRAPHLENS-883: Expired credential for dependency graph visualizer**

Graphlens stopped rendering builds at 02:10. Cause: service account token for the Depmapper fetch API expired. No compromise indicators; rotation was scheduled. Old key revoked. New key scoped read-only to graph metadata, 90-day expiry, logged per policy. For your review, the replacement key issued to svc-graphlens is below.

gateway credential: kto23_LX9A4ys6i4nzHtpOLNLodKK